Memories

To Daddy:

No matter how much I cling it slowly slips away
And All those vivid colors are fading into gray

That golden gleam is now a red rust
And those snow white pages are coated in dust

The burning brilliance that was you has turned to ash
And that fiery soul has vanished in a flash

That beautiful face has faded with time
But it wasn't so long ago I called you mine
